**Q: Why is the audio waveform preview blank or flat for some uploads?**

A: Usually one of three causes: the file is still being processed by Soundloom (previews appear within two minutes), the upload uses an unsupported codec, or the track is silent for its first thirty seconds, which the renderer misreads. Ask the customer to re-upload as WAV or standard MP3 if processing never completes. Supported codecs and known rendering quirks are listed on the internal reference page.

operations page: https://jenkins.zemvarcloud.local/job/merge_requests/repo/build/73930b4b30f0a8ed

### Action Item 7: Tame the Quillspool retry storm

So, the spooler happily re-queued every stuck print job at once when the Brindle office fleet came back online, which is how we melted the queue for two hours. Fix is straightforward: jittered backoff, a cap on concurrent resubmissions, and a dead-letter shelf for jobs older than a day. Future maintainers: resist the urge to raise these. The limits we settled on are as follows.

tuning table, kajog-bawip:
TIERS = {
    "kelius": 256,
    "lammir": 543,
}

# Consent Banner Rollout — Who to Contact

The Lanterbrook consent banner is rolling out in phases across all Quillhaven web properties. Phase two covers the storefront and help portal. For copy changes, ping the compliance guild channel; for rendering bugs, file against the banner repo. For rollout timing or exemptions, reach the rollout coordinator directly.

escalation mailbox, yajeg-bageg: quenax.olidor@lumiccorp.internal

Compaction on the Marrowick queue cluster trades disk reclaim speed against broker CPU. During peak ingest we defer compaction; overnight we run it aggressively so segment counts stay below the mmap ceiling. Please do not change these values without a capacity review, since undersized dirty ratios caused the Delverton incident. Current settings:

tuning table, faduf-baduf:
PRIORITIES = {
    "ulavan": 191,
    "silys": 750,
    "goriel": 238,
    "kelmir": 66,
    "wendor": 432,
}